Output e74fe44d32856a6bf0805934ba4f4cc5038cd7f948d6ca7a38865ec351231123:0

value
1015000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 79e366e2cb7ac3039ced861fc2181b9a172f33b2 OP_EQUAL
address
3CoW6v63umcB6UMBQkjoTmqen69kksgwK7
transaction
e74fe44d32856a6bf0805934ba4f4cc5038cd7f948d6ca7a38865ec351231123
spent
true